For scrummy Ethiopian food which suits vegans (fasting food), meat lovers and the wheat / gluten sensitive (Ethiopian bread - injera - is made of teff flour, so no wheat allergens) alike, at very reasonable prices.
53 locals recommend
Zeret Kitchen
216-218 Camberwell RdFor scrummy Ethiopian food which suits vegans (fasting food), meat lovers and the wheat / gluten sensitive (Ethiopian bread - injera - is made of teff flour, so no wheat allergens) alike, at very reasonable prices.

Grab some lunch at top foodie hangout with cafes and takeaway street food stalls in abundance. If Southwark Cathedral Gardens have no seats left, try walking down Redcross Way to Redcross Cottages and Garden for a charming secluded green space in the sun passing the medieval graveyard on the way.
1616 locals recommend
Borough Market
